What you need to know about the NS55 Vouchers

To celebrate 55 years of National Service, MINDEF and the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A) are giving out recognition packages for past and present national servicemen. Now’s a good time to check your letter boxes – all eligible folks will get a hardcopy notification via mail.

$100 worth of credits will be distributed from 1st – 31st July 2022 via the LifeSG application (iOS, Android). The best part? These credits are valid for a whole year and can be used at plenty of merchants across Singapore – both online and offline. 

Best places to redeem your NS55 vouchers 

From bubble tea to staycations, any business that accepts payment by “Scan and Pay” via PayNow UEN or NETS QR are on board. We sifted through the 130 participating merchants and below are 16 of the most exciting things you can spend your $100 NS55 credits on.
